Lacey School Board Celebrates Record AP Scores Amid Budget and Infrastructure Discussions
- Meeting Overview:
The Lacey School Board meeting highlighted the district’s academic achievements while addressing ongoing infrastructure projects and financial matters. The district celebrated a significant academic milestone, with 66.5% of Advanced Placement (AP) students scoring a three or above. Additionally, the board discussed progress on roof construction projects and updates on financial negotiations and health benefits.
One item at the meeting was the report on the district’s AP results. The superintendent expressed gratitude towards Mr. Zylinski for his leadership during challenging times. The district recorded its highest number of AP tests taken, 376, in six years. The board acknowledged the efforts of students and educators in reaching this milestone, expressing hope for continued success.
Infrastructure updates were another focal point, with progress reported on the high school and Cedar Creek roof construction. These projects have impacted facility usage, with indoor requests being denied due to ongoing work, although outdoor facilities remain available to the community.
Financial discussions included an update on the district’s health benefits, with the decision to remain in the school health benefit system. The board also addressed upcoming negotiations regarding the LCBA contract and the approval of the district’s preschool funding application by the Department of Education. Additionally, the district’s partnership with Point Pleasant for Title III federal funding and updates on the NutriServe onboarding process were discussed.
In personnel matters, the board announced the transfer of Mrs. Kilmer back to the Lanoka Harbor School, recognizing her contributions over the past eight years. Mr. Chessly was appointed to fill her role, bringing new ideas and energy to the district.
